Quick note for support folks: Meterline enforces per-tenant rate quotas, so if a customer reports throttling, check their tier in the quota panel before escalating — most cases are just plan limits. If you need to query the quota service directly, your local env file must first include this line:

sealed setting: VAULT_KEY20=dd440a383707adecf165

**Q: Why are stale prices showing in the Bramblecart catalog?**

Cache invalidation in Bramblecart is event-driven. Product edits publish to the purge topic; the edge layer drops keys within ~30s. If stale data persists, check the purge consumer lag first — it stalls silently after schema changes. Do not flush the whole cache in peak hours. Full invalidation flowcharts and consumer restart steps are documented on the internal page below.

runbook for badug-kadup: https://confluence.zemvarlabs.internal/projects/browse/display/projects/bd1b

Fan-out backpressure for the Quillet notifier: when the queue depth crosses the soft limit, the dispatcher sheds low-priority pushes and batches the rest at 500ms intervals. Reviewer should confirm the shed counter is exported and that retries respect the jitter window. Once merged, the release artifact gets re-signed by the pipeline, which expects the deploy key shown below.

deploy key for bawep-yawif: bky6_GQhaSt

[ ] Antique mantel clock (Hallward estate lot 12) to be crated and sent to Merrow & Tine Horology in Ashpool for escapement repair. Confirm the felt-lined crate is sealed, photograph all four faces before closing, and log the condition sheet in the Hallward file. The courier hand-over instruction for this item is as follows.

handover note for yagef-bagep: the drudor pelius courier leaves the kasdor zorvan norir ledger at gate 8016 under passcode 755406